Top 10 formal Outfits for interview
Have a look at these interview dresses for men:

  1. White Shirt and Black Pants – This is the most classic combination for making a good impression during an interview. You can opt for plain white shirts or simple patterns on a white shirt.
  2. Blue Shirt and Navy Pants – Combine a light blue shirt with navy blue pants to make a monochromatic outfit.
  3. Pink Shirt with Grey Pants – A pink shirt and grey pants make an unconventional interview dress for men, but if you are applying for a job that needs you to make bold decisions, this outfit will surely make a good impression on the employer.
  4. White & Blue Check Shirt with Black Pants – Pair a white and blue check shirt with black pants to get a simple and elegant look for the interview. Avoid large checks; instead, go for smaller check patterns.
  5. Formal Blue Suit with White Shirt – If you are going for the senior manager role, it is better to wear a suit, instead of a pant-shirt combo. A blue suit with a white shirt is one of the best men’s formal wear for the interview.
  6. Black Suit with Blue Shirt – Do not wear a black suit with a white shirt, as it looks too dressy. Instead, wear it with a formal blue shirt to look professional and well-dressed.
  7. Simple Stripe Shirt with Blue Pants – Stripes look formal, and you can wear a striped shirt for your interview. Just ensure that the base colour is white and the stripes are not too broad. You can wear a blue and yellow stripe shirt with blue pants.
  8. Grey Shirt with Black Pants- Grey is also a neutral colour, and you can wear a full-sleeved grey shirt with black pants for the interview.
  9. Dark Colour Shirt with Light Colour Pants – If you do not have white or light blue shirts, you can pair your dark colour shirts with light colour pants to look professional. Dark blue, maroon, or mustard colour shirts look formal, and you can pair them with beige and cream colour pants.
  10. Colourful Shirt with Tie – You can pair your formal checkered shirts with plain ties to make your outfit more professional. You can pair a red formal check shirt with a black tie and black pants.

Interview dress for men: Why is it necessary to dress properly for an interview?

Dressing properly for an interview is not just about following etiquette; it’s about presenting yourself in the best possible way. You should pick formal wear for an interview.

Here are some benefits of wearing a formal dress for men for interviews:

1. First Impressions

Your appearance is the first thing that the employer will notice about you. A neat and professional outfit conveys that you are taking the opportunity seriously and you respect the interviewer’s time.

2. Professionalism 

Most workplaces have a dress code for formal wear. Wearing formal dress for the interview makes you look professional and prepared to be a part of the work environment. Employers often assess how well a candidate will fit into their organization based on their appearance and demeanour.

3. Confidence Boost

Dressing well can boost your confidence. When you feel good about your appearance, you will be more confident during the interview. This will increase your chances of selection.

4. Shows Respect For The Role

Dressing appropriately shows that you respect the position you’re applying for. This also displays your respect and appreciation for the company’s culture. Formal interview wear indicates that you’ve done your homework and understand the expectations of the workplace.

5. Non-verbal Communication 

Clothing, grooming, and mannerisms are forms of non-verbal communication. This can influence what the employer thinks about you without saying a word. If you are dressed in casual clothes, the employer might think that you are not serious about the interview despite your qualifications.

Tips to Make Your Interview Formal Outfit Perfect

Here are some tips for making your formal dress for the interview flawless and perfect:

  • Do your Research: Understand the dress code of the company you’re interviewing for, and try to dress accordingly.
  • Choose a Well-Fitted Outfit: Opt for a tailored pant in a neutral colour like navy, grey, or black. Pick a long-sleeved dress shirt in white or light blue. Your clothes should not be too loose or too tight.
  • Tie: Select a crisp and conservative tie that compliments your shirt. Do not pick a tie with a bold colour or vibrant pattern.
  • Footwear: Wear polished dress shoes that are comfortable and appropriate for the occasion. Black or brown leather shoes are usually the best choice. Make sure your shoes do not make much noise during walking.
  • Grooming: Pay attention to your hair, nails and facial hair. Personal hygiene is crucial for making a good impression.
  • Iron and Clean Clothes: Iron your clothes before the interview to ensure they are wrinkle-free. Make sure your outfit is clean and free of stains or odour.

What Not to Wear to an Interview

Knowing what not to wear for a job interview is equally important. This way, you can avoid mistakes and have a good first impression on the recruiter.

  1. Do not wear bright and vibrant colours for the interview. Wear soft and neutral colours to look professional.
  2. Never show up to an interview in t-shirts, shorts, or joggers. Invest in a proper formal dress for the interview.
  3. Do not wear sandals or slippers for the interview. Wear proper formal shoes. Avoid loud and vibrant sneakers or sports shoes too. 
  4. Avoid chunky accessories like big watches, sunglasses, chains or bracelets. Wear a smart formal watch if you want, but avoid any other accessories.
  5. Do not wear too much perfume or cologne. Add a subtle body mist to avoid bad odour but do not apply deodorant or perfume with harsh fragrances.
